Some BONs actually have language requirements and will not let you take the NCLEX exam until you have proof of passing the English exams. Some are TOEFL, and some are actually the TSE.

The reason that I always recommend the IELTS over the TOEFL series is that most have issues with the speaking part. With the IELTS, you get a human 1:1, with TOEFL, you speak into esnetially a tape recorder. Soem do not do well that way, especially the Filipinos. They do much better with the IELTS series.

Massachusetts has required the TSE, Maryland the TOEFL, Illinois the TOEFL.

California lists a requirement of passing the English exam but they do not ask for any documentation, the others do. There are other states as well.
